The Unruly Queens chess club is hosting a tournament, and each club member is bringing something to eat or drink. Kristen decides to bring oatmeal raisin cookies from her favorite bakery.
There is a proportional relationship between the number of oatmeal raisin cookies Kristen buys, x, and their total cost (in dollars), y.
x (cookies) y (dollars)
10 $10
11 $11
17 $17
19 $19
What is the constant of proportionality? Write your answer as a whole number or decimal.
dollars per cookie

To find the constant of proportionality in this scenario, we look at the relationship between the number of cookies \( x \) and the total cost \( y \).

The constant of proportionality can be calculated by dividing the total cost \( y \) by the number of cookies \( x \).

From the provided data:

\[
\text{Constant of proportionality} = \frac{y}{x}
\]

Calculating for the provided pairs:

1. For \( x = 10 \), \( y = 10 \):
\[
\frac{10}{10} = 1
\]

2. For \( x = 11 \), \( y = 11 \):
\[
\frac{11}{11} = 1
\]

3. For \( x = 17 \), \( y = 17 \):
\[
\frac{17}{17} = 1
\]

4. For \( x = 19 \), \( y = 19 \):
\[
\frac{19}{19} = 1
\]

In each case, we find that the constant of proportionality is \( 1 \) dollar per cookie.

Thus, the constant of proportionality is:

\[
\boxed{1}
\]
